Expanding Digital Reach: Nintendo's Account and Online Service Growth

Nintendo's latest financial update highlights impressive growth in its digital ecosystem, with 400 million registered Nintendo Accounts and 34 million active Nintendo Switch Online subscribers as of September 30, 2025. These figures demonstrate the company's successful efforts in broadening its digital footprint and enhancing user engagement across its platforms. The substantial number of annual playing users, totaling 128 million, further illustrates the vibrant and active community that regularly interacts with Nintendo's software and services.

This growth is a testament to Nintendo's ongoing strategy of fostering strong consumer relationships and extending its influence beyond core gaming. The company's definition of annual playing users, which includes any Nintendo Account that has accessed Switch or Switch 2 software at least once within a 12-month period, provides a clear measure of active participation.
